These dates have a soft, moist texture with rich natural sweetness. The flavour can remind customers of caramel, brown sugar, honey and mild chocolate notes, making them enjoyable on their own or paired with tea, coffee, milk, nuts, yoghurt and breakfast bowls.</p>
Although they are described as honey dates for their naturally honey-like sweetness, they are not honey-coated. The sweetness comes naturally from the Mozafati dates themselves.
Honey Dates are different from dried red dates, dry dates and some pitted dates. Dried red dates usually refer to Chinese red dates or jujube, which are a different fruit. Dry dates are firmer and lower in moisture. Pitted dates have the seed removed, while Bam dates are commonly sold as whole soft dates unless the packaging specifically states pitted.

Bam dates usually refer to Mazafati or Mozafati dates associated with Bam in Kerman, Iran. They are a well-known soft date style appreciated for their dark colour, moist flesh and rich natural sweetness.

Bam dates and Medjool dates are both sweet date varieties, but they have different eating textures. Bam dates are usually softer, darker, more moist and more tender, while Medjool dates are often larger, chewier and more fibrous.
| Feature | Bam Dates | Medjool Dates |
| Texture | Soft, moist and tender | Chewy, meaty and fibrous |
| Colour | Dark brown to almost black | Brown to amber-brown |
| Flavour | Caramel-like, brown sugar-like and honey-like | Rich, caramel-like and chewy |
| Best For | Soft snacking, Ramadan, tea, desserts and smoothies | Stuffed dates, snacking, baking and gifting |
Customers sometimes compare Honey Dates with pitted dates, dry dates and dried red dates. These are different product styles, so it is useful to choose based on texture and usage.
Pitted dates have the seed removed. Dry dates are firmer and lower in moisture. Dried red dates usually refer to Chinese red dates or jujube, which are a different fruit from date palm dates. Customers searching for bam dates benefits are usually looking for general nutrition information. Dates can be enjoyed as part of a balanced diet and contain naturally occurring carbohydrates, fibre, potassium and small amounts of minerals.
Because dates are naturally high in sugar, they are best enjoyed in moderation, especially for customers watching sugar intake. This is general nutrition information and should not be treated as medical advice.
